Watch “Leyden 212 Presentation on Vaping at Leyden Parent University” on YouTube


According to the CDC, more than 3.6 million middle and high school students used e-cigarettes over a 30-day span in 2018. That figure includes 4.9% of middle schoolers 20.8% of high schoolers. See the Leyden High School presentation on “vaping”.

Dozens of Illinois prisoners could be released when governor signs recreational pot bill


Of Illinois’ almost 40,000 inmates housed in state Department of Corrections facilities, a few dozen of them might be eligible for release if the recreational marijuana bill becomes law. According to the Illinois Department of Corrections, as of April 30, … Continue reading
